6 | 7 | | R E S O L U T I O N |
---|
7 | 8 | | WHEREAS, Christine Mihealsick of the Round Rock Independent |
---|
8 | 9 | | School District has been named the 2025 Texas Teacher of the Year by |
---|
9 | 10 | | the Texas Association of School Administrators; and |
---|
10 | 11 | | WHEREAS, Each year, outstanding educators from across the |
---|
11 | 12 | | country are selected as State Teachers of the Year as part of the |
---|
12 | 13 | | National Teacher of the Year initiative run by the Council of Chief |
---|
13 | 14 | | State School Officers; the cohort of honorees is given the |
---|
14 | 15 | | opportunity to participate in a yearlong professional development |
---|
15 | 16 | | program, and they are narrowed to a number of finalists by a |
---|
16 | 17 | | committee of representatives from various education organizations; |
---|
17 | 18 | | one candidate is ultimately named National Teacher of the Year, who |
---|
18 | 19 | | then travels the country to share their wisdom, elevate issues |
---|
19 | 20 | | faced by members of their profession, and inspire others to enter |
---|
20 | 21 | | the field of teaching; and |
---|
21 | 22 | | WHEREAS, Chris Mihealsick has enjoyed a rewarding career in |
---|
22 | 23 | | education that has spanned 23 years, and she currently teaches |
---|
23 | 24 | | 11th- and 12th-grade Advanced Placement environmental science at |
---|
24 | 25 | | Westwood High School, where she is also the science department |
---|
25 | 26 | | chair; her teaching focuses on building positive relationships and |
---|
26 | 27 | | fostering a respectful learning environment in the classroom, and |
---|
27 | 28 | | she frequently engages her students in fieldwork and real-world |
---|
28 | 29 | | case studies; she holds a bachelor's degree in biology and a |
---|
29 | 30 | | master's degree in science education from The University of Texas |
---|
30 | 31 | | at Austin; and |
---|
31 | 32 | | WHEREAS, A National Board Certified Teacher, Ms. Mihealsick |
---|
32 | 33 | | has previously been selected for a Fulbright exchange program to |
---|
33 | 34 | | Japan and the Toyota International Teacher Program in Costa Rica, |
---|
34 | 35 | | and she also took part in the Northrop Grumman ECO Classroom program |
---|
35 | 36 | | for tropical research; she has consulted for the National Math and |
---|
36 | 37 | | Science Initiative for eight years, and she has been a College Board |
---|
37 | 38 | | AP exam reader for more than a decade; in addition, she is the only |
---|
38 | 39 | | UT alumnus to have twice won the prestigious R. L. Moore Award for |
---|
39 | 40 | | inquiry-based teaching from the university's UTeach program; she |
---|
40 | 41 | | was concurrently recognized as the 2025 Texas Secondary Teacher of |
---|
41 | 42 | | the Year by TASA; and |
---|
42 | 43 | | WHEREAS, Chris Mihealsick exemplifies the passion, |
---|
43 | 44 | | determination, and innovative spirit that are the hallmarks of our |
---|
44 | 45 | | best teachers, and she has set a standard of excellence to which all |
---|
45 | 46 | | in her profession may aspire; now, therefore, be it |
---|
46 | 47 | | R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 89th Texas |
---|
47 | 48 | | Legislature hereby congratulate Christine Mihealsick on her |
---|
48 | 49 | | selection as the 2025 Texas Teacher of the Year by the Texas |
---|
49 | 50 | | Association of School Administrators and extend to her sincere best |
---|
50 | 51 | | wishes for continued success with her important work; and, be it |
---|
51 | 52 | | further |
---|
52 | 53 | | RESOLVED, That an official copy of this resolution be |
---|
53 | 54 | | prepared for Ms. Mihealsick as an expression of high regard by the |
---|
54 | 55 | | Texas House of Representatives. |
